NCover

Goals

  • Simplicity
  • Speed - it doesn't profile, it just checks coverage.
  • Designed to be dropped into a continuous build cycle
  • Keep line numbers the same -> Test failure stacktraces stay useful

Upgrading from previous NCover versions

There are three breaking changes with this new release, these are: To compile instrumented code, you will now need to reference the NCover.dll The NAnt tasks have been seperated out into a seperate assembly (NCoverNAnt.dll), so you will now have to reference this assembly in the loadtasks part of the nant build file. The ncoverreport task now takes a mandatory parameter named "actuals" which is a filename pointing to the output from running the tests upon the instrumented code. Please see the docs for further details.

News

2013-01-09

  • Version 0.9.2 released see changelog for details
  • Now supports Visual Basic.NET code!
  • We've enhanced the diff functionality so you can see how changes to the code have affected the coverage percentage (for better or for worse).
  • Thanks to ideas from Michael Luke, setting up ncover is now easier than before - you just have to link to the dll. (well maybe a little bit more than that is needed, but it's easier than it was.) (Thanks Michael)
